The asymptotic density of finite-order elements in virtually nilpotent groups
Abstract
Let G be a finitely generated group with a given word metric. The asymptotic density of elements in G that have a particular property P is defined to be the limit, as r goes to infinity, of the proportion of elements in the ball of radius r which have the property P. We obtain a formula to compute the asymptotic density of finite-order elements in any virtually nilpotent group. Further, we show that the spectrum of numbers that occur as such asymptotic densities consists of exactly the rational numbers in [0,1).
